It is certainly possible to a script or program out of the Savegroup Failure
Notification so you can pretty much do whatever you want. NetWorker passes
it's report to whatever it starts for the notification and after that you're on
your own for parsing it and distributing it as you wish. It's something I
played around with a decade or so ago but I'm not up on the details any more.
